Home > C,C++ > Interpreters

Interpreters

Fast math parsers. EquTranslator & CxTranslator.  
It's a fast math evaluator with parse-tree builder and user-friendly interface for parsing and calculation a run-time defined math expression. CxTranslator is parser for complex numbers math exp. The math expressions is represented as string in a function style F(x1, x2,..., xn) =f(x1, x2,..., xn). The main characteristics of the parsers: · extremely fast, · procedural and OOP implementation, · unlimited number of variables, · exception mechanism provided, · ASCII and UNICODE supports, · can be extended by user defined functions and constants. ------------------------------------------------------------------ Key words: math parser arithmetic complex component dll equation formula function expression scientific evaluator evaluate calculate parse c++ delphi vb net c# interpretator programming statistics science computation calculator engineering solver fast
Submitted: Oct 23, 2004
The CINT C/C++ Interpreter  
This is a C/C++ interpreter which is aimed at processing C/C++ scripts. Scripts are programs which perform specific tasks. Generally execution time is not critical, but rapid development is. Using an interpreter the compile and link cycle is dramatically reduced facilitating rapid development. CINT covers about 95% of ANSI C and 85% of C++. CINT, written in ANSI C (about 80000 loc), is solid enough to interpret itself and let the interpreted version execute a program.
Submitted: Jan 16, 2000
interpcom  
Interpcom is a command interpreter library in C that can be used to build scientific applications. It is very easy to add new commands. The library contains an expression evaluator that can be used to parse the arguments of the commands. It is possible to define "objects" which are arrays of numbers having a name, and structures. It is possible to use threads (several programs running simultaneously). The distribution contains a mathematical and graphic application.
Submitted: Jan 16, 2000
[FREESW]CH  
CH is a superset of C interpreter. With its new features, CH is a very high-level language (VHLL) environment and is as easy to use as Basic. CH can be used for Unix/Windows shell programming, WWW Common Gateway Interface (CGI), world-wide distributed network computing, scientific computing, real-time control of mechatronic systems, and many other applications.
Submitted: Apr 24, 1998



  Privacy - Trademarks - Feedback - Terms of Use Copyright The MathWorks, Inc.